GlueStartJobRunProps

class aws_cdk.aws_stepfunctions_tasks.GlueStartJobRunProps(*, comment=None, heartbeat=None, input_path=None, integration_pattern=None, output_path=None, result_path=None, result_selector=None, timeout=None, glue_job_name, arguments=None, notify_delay_after=None, security_configuration=None)

Bases: TaskStateBaseProps

Properties for starting an AWS Glue job as a task.

Parameters:
  • comment (Optional[str]) – An optional description for this state. Default: - No comment

  • heartbeat (Optional[Duration]) – Timeout for the heartbeat. Default: - None

  • input_path (Optional[str]) – JSONPath expression to select part of the state to be the input to this state. May also be the special value JsonPath.DISCARD, which will cause the effective input to be the empty object {}. Default: - The entire task input (JSON path ‘$’)

  • integration_pattern (Optional[IntegrationPattern]) – AWS Step Functions integrates with services directly in the Amazon States Language. You can control these AWS services using service integration patterns Default: - IntegrationPattern.REQUEST_RESPONSE for most tasks. IntegrationPattern.RUN_JOB for the following exceptions: BatchSubmitJob, EmrAddStep, EmrCreateCluster, EmrTerminationCluster, and EmrContainersStartJobRun.

  • output_path (Optional[str]) – JSONPath expression to select select a portion of the state output to pass to the next state. May also be the special value JsonPath.DISCARD, which will cause the effective output to be the empty object {}. Default: - The entire JSON node determined by the state input, the task result, and resultPath is passed to the next state (JSON path ‘$’)

  • result_path (Optional[str]) – JSONPath expression to indicate where to inject the state’s output. May also be the special value JsonPath.DISCARD, which will cause the state’s input to become its output. Default: - Replaces the entire input with the result (JSON path ‘$’)

  • result_selector (Optional[Mapping[str, Any]]) – The JSON that will replace the state’s raw result and become the effective result before ResultPath is applied. You can use ResultSelector to create a payload with values that are static or selected from the state’s raw result. Default: - None

  • timeout (Optional[Duration]) – Timeout for the state machine. Default: - None

  • glue_job_name (str) – Glue job name.

  • arguments (Optional[TaskInput]) – The job arguments specifically for this run. For this job run, they replace the default arguments set in the job definition itself. Default: - Default arguments set in the job definition

  • notify_delay_after (Optional[Duration]) – After a job run starts, the number of minutes to wait before sending a job run delay notification. Must be at least 1 minute. Default: - Default delay set in the job definition

  • security_configuration (Optional[str]) – The name of the SecurityConfiguration structure to be used with this job run. This must match the Glue API Default: - Default configuration set in the job definition

ExampleMetadata:

infused

Example:

tasks.GlueStartJobRun(self, "Task",
    glue_job_name="my-glue-job",
    arguments=sfn.TaskInput.from_object({
        "key": "value"
    }),
    timeout=Duration.minutes(30),
    notify_delay_after=Duration.minutes(5)
)
